WebApr 14, 2024 · But the implications of AMR go beyond health, it affects humans, animals, crops, and the environment. In 2016, the World Bank estimated that by 2050, AMR may result in a further 28 million people living in poverty, a 7.5% decline in global livestock production, a 3.8% reduction in global exports, and 1 trillion USD in additional healthcare costs.
